On Mon, Sep 15, 2003 at 01:40:29PM -0400, Arlo wrote: > I have an A7N8X Deluxe motherboard with built in Sil3112a serial ata > controller and a Seagate Barracuda serial ata harddisk. I'm getting random, or > semi-random system lockups. The lockups happen more when the system is under > load. This is documented well on sites like http://www.nforcershq.com > I also do not get a harddrive led (for activity). > I have tried all the fixes I can find in the archives.
I had similar problems with that a7n8x-delux board with IDE drives. Random lockups under high HD or network load IIRC. I ended up fixing this by going to ac-sources, which have the proper drivers for the nforce2 chipset. Run "dmesg | grep -i nforce" and see if anything shows up. There'll be an option in the kernel config ATA/IDE/etc->Block Devices <*> AMD and nVidia IDE support There are also nvidia nforce specific options in the Sound section, and under Character Devices->AGPGART.
